So, 'Back - fortunately, or Who will find the Blue Bird' is a curious little comedy from 2011. It captures that New Year's Eve vibe, where the air is thick with possibility and a bit of magic. The story revolves around Masha, a practical girl who isn't buying into the whole miracle thing, especially not on a night like December 31. What’s intriguing is the way it juxtaposes her skepticism against the festive backdrop. The pacing is a bit uneven at times, but it carries this whimsical atmosphere that feels almost dreamlike. Practical effects are minimal, but they fit the narrative without overshadowing the performances—especially Masha, who brings a certain groundedness to the chaos. The film's distinctive charm lies in its exploration of belief and hope, all wrapped up in a lighthearted package.
